With countless platforms and methods available, it can be overwhelming to find the best way to make $100 a day online. Thankfully, we have do...One can day trade in a cash account. However, there is a caveat. In a cash account, all proceeds from sales have a 2 day settle time (T+2). So one could day trade but not much. Consider if one had $1000 in an account. One could buy and sell $500 of AAPL but only do that 2 times in a day (ie the proceeds from sales wouldn’t be …

The bottom line Pattern Day Trading (PDT) is a designation that only applies to margin-enabled accounts. You will permanently become designated as a pattern day trader in a margin account after placing 4 day trades within a 5 business day period, or if you have 2 unmet day trade calls within 90 days. For those looking for an answer as to whether day trading rules apply to cash accounts, you may be disappointed. The rules for non-margin, cash accounts, stipulate that trading is on the whole not allowed. They are allowed only to the extent that the trades do not violate the free-riding prohibitions of Federal Reserve Board’s Regulation T.
